BYERS v. COMMISSIONER

Docket No. 46409.

14 T.C.M. 153 (1955)

T.C. Memo. 1955-45

William C. Byers and Bernice B. Byers v. Commissioner.

United States Tax Court.

Filed February 24, 1955.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Harry H. Meisner, Esq., Box 367, Anchorage, Alaska, for the petitioners. Walter T. Hart, Esq., for the respondent.


Memorandum Findings of Fact and Opinion

This proceeding involves deficiencies in income taxes determined against petitioners for the years 1949 and 1950 in the amounts of $276.56 and $3,559.24, respectively.

The issues to be decided are: (1) whether a $12,200 loss sustained by petitioner in 1950 was a business or a nonbusiness bad debt; (2) whether unreimbursed expenses incurred in moving to another locality to accept new employment are deductible expenses...
